The Real Cost of Manually Generating Equipment Recommendations
For occupational therapists managing heavy patient caseloads, manually crafting detailed equipment recommendations is a time-consuming ordeal that strains their already busy schedules. Each recommendation involves extensive research to identify the perfect tools tailored to the specific needs of individual patients—be it a pediatric client with fine motor challenges or an adult dealing with upper limb weakness post-stroke.
This process requires carefully reviewing multiple vendor catalogs, cross-referencing with patient assessments, and then drafting custom narratives that articulate how each recommended device can be effectively integrated into the therapy plan. When done manually, this task often takes 30-45 minutes per recommendation, significantly extending the time spent on clinical documentation.
Moreover, inadequate equipment recommendations not only compromise the quality of care provided but also increase the likelihood of denied insurance claims or additional costs for out-of-network devices. The financial implications are severe when therapists fail to justify medical necessity in their recommendations, leading to rejected prior authorizations and delayed therapy starts. This directly impacts clinic revenue and scheduling efficiency, requiring patients to wait longer for critical interventions.

Free AI Prompt: Generate Patient-Specific Equipment Recommendations
This prompt allows occupational therapists to quickly generate detailed equipment recommendations tailored to each unique patient need. By providing key details about the patient's condition and therapy goals, the AI can instantly produce a comprehensive list of recommended devices that fit seamlessly into the treatment plan.
You are an occupational therapist specializing in pediatric patients. Generate a detailed equipment recommendation for [Patient Name], who is a 6-year-old boy with fine motor challenges due to [Condition, e.g., cerebral palsy]. His primary therapy goals include improving hand-eye coordination and grasping abilities.
Based on these needs, please recommend at least three occupational therapy tools or devices that would effectively support the patient's therapy progress. For each recommendation:
- Clearly state the device name, brand, and model.
- Explain how it addresses the specific fine motor challenges.
- Detail its integration into the treatment plan.
- Justify medical necessity to obtain insurance approval.
Structure your recommendations in a professional narrative format.
Do not use real PII.
